For the incoming director: this quarter we recorded a write-down on the Ostrel line of finished goods held at the Brinwald warehouse, reflecting obsolescence after the model refresh. The adjustment was reviewed by controlling and booked in full rather than staged. Remaining stock will be cleared through the outlet channel by end of next quarter; no further impairment is expected unless demand softens materially. Please review the disposal schedule before the planning call. Context on the broader plan appears below.

internal memo for hahaf-kahof: Only 39 of the 428 pilot accounts renewed Sorion, so a churn review is set for April 12. Praokix Freight is in early talks to buy Queniusox Group for about $145.8 million.

**Q: How does the revamped password reset affect my plugin?**

With Plumset 4.2, reset tokens are single-use and scoped per plugin surface. Plugins must re-request user consent after a reset completes; cached session hooks are invalidated. To regenerate your sandbox signing material after testing resets, unlock the developer keystore with the passphrase below.

recovery phrase for fajep-yajef: istwyn-quenok

## Configuration

We're midway through migrating Lanternway's build from ad-hoc shell scripts to the hermetic Sealcrate system. Under Sealcrate, builds run in isolated sandboxes with no ambient network or host toolchain access, so every input must be declared explicitly. Legacy targets still read configuration from a local env file until migration completes. Copy `env.sample` to `.env` before your first build, then add the artifact-store credential on the line directly below this sentence.

vault entry, yahif-yajep: COURIER_KEY29=b802bdf8034096b65a51c6ba5abe2

## Configuration

ContrastCheck audits every page in a customer's theme and flags color pairs below WCAG thresholds. Support folks: most config lives in contrastcheck.yml — thresholds, ignored selectors, report format. You rarely need to touch it. The one thing you will set up on a fresh support sandbox is the env file, since the audit runner authenticates to the reporting backend with a credential stored there. Drop this line into .env.

vault entry, fahaf-yajop: RELAY_SECRET5=d4d0e